构建数字孪生的工具和实现方法

以下是关于构建数字孪生的工具和实现方法的详细总结,结合技术发展和行业实践,从工具分类、核心技术架构到具体实施步骤进行梳理:

一、构建数字孪生的核心工具分类

数字孪生的工具链覆盖从数据采集、建模、仿真到应用的全流程,可分为以下几类:

1. 数据采集与物联网(IoT)工具

传感器与硬件

工业传感器:温度/压力传感器(如西门子SITRANS)、振动传感器(如PCB Piezotronics)、视觉传感器(如Basler工业相机)。
物联网平台:

AWS IoT Core:支持设备连接、数据存储与规则引擎,适合大规模设备接入。
Azure IoT Hub:提供设备管理、数据路由和边缘计算(如Azure IoT Edge)。
西门子MindSphere:工业级IoT平台,集成设备监控与数字孪生建模能力。

边缘计算工具:NVIDIA Jetson(边缘AI计算)、研华UNO系列(工业边缘网关),用于数据预处理和实时响应。

2. 建模与仿真工具

几何建模工具

CAD软件:AutoCAD(二维/三维)、SolidWorks(参数化机械设计)、CATIA(复杂曲面建模,航空航天/汽车领域)。
高精度建模:3D扫描仪(如FARO Focus)+ 逆向工程软件(Geomagic Design X),用于物理实体数字化。
场景建模:Unity/Unreal Engine(高逼真场景渲染,适合智慧城市、工厂数字孪生)。

物理与行为建模工具

多物理场仿真:ANSYS(结构/流体/电磁耦合)、COMSOL Multiphysics(偏微分方程建模)。
系统级仿真:MATLAB/Simulink(动态系统建模,如控制算法仿真)、AnyLogic(离散事件与连续系统混合仿真)。
数字线程工具:PTC Creo(产品全生命周期建模,连接设计-制造-运维数据)。

数据驱动建模(AI辅助)

机器学习框架:TensorFlow/PyTorch(基于历史数据训练预测模型,如设备故障预测)。
数字孪生专用工具:Seeq(时序数据关联分析)、Uptake(工业设备性能建模)。

3. 数据管理与平台工具

数据库与存储

时序数据库:InfluxDB(高效存储传感器时间序列数据)、TimescaleDB(PostgreSQL时序扩展)。
图数据库:Neo4j(建模实体间关系,如设备零部件关联)。

数字孪生平台

通用平台

PTC ThingWorx(低代码构建数字孪生,支持API集成)。
GE Predix(工业资产性能管理,集成AI分析)。

行业专用平台

西门子Xcelerator(覆盖产品设计到生产的数字孪生)。
达索3DEXPERIENCE(全产业链协同,适合复杂产品生命周期管理)。

4. 可视化与交互工具

2D/3D可视化

商业工具:Tableau/Power BI(数据仪表盘)、ThingWorx Vision(工业可视化)。
开源工具:Three.js(Web端3D渲染)、ECharts(数据图表)。

沉浸式交互

VR/AR工具:Unity XR/UE XR(结合HoloLens等设备实现虚实交互)。
数字孪生驾驶舱:CitectSCADA(工业监控)、CityMaker(智慧城市三维可视化)。

5. 开发与集成工具

API与中间件:Postman(API调试)、Node-RED(低代码数据流编排)。
版本控制:Git(模型与代码协同)、PTC Windchill(产品数据管理)。

二、数字孪生实现方法与技术架构

数字孪生的构建遵循“物理实体映射→数据驱动→智能应用”的逻辑,核心步骤如下:

1. 定义数字孪生目标与架构

明确应用场景

工业:设备预测性维护、产线优化;
城市:交通流量模拟、能耗管理;
医疗:手术模拟、患者健康监测。

三层技术架构

物理层:实体对象(设备/产线/城市)+ 传感器网络。
虚拟层:几何模型+物理仿真+数据驱动模型(实时同步物理状态)。
应用层:可视化界面+分析工具(故障诊断、优化决策)。

2. 物理实体数字化建模

多维度建模

几何建模:通过CAD/3D扫描构建精确三维模型(STL/OBJ格式)。
物理建模:基于材料属性、力学方程(如FEM有限元)定义物理行为。
行为建模:通过仿真工具(Simulink/AnyLogic)描述动态逻辑(如设备启停规则)。
规则建模:定义业务逻辑(如报警阈值、维护策略)。

轻量化处理:使用LOD(细节层次)技术优化模型,确保实时渲染效率。

3. 数据采集与实时同步

数据接入

传感器数据:通过MQTT/OPC UA协议从PLC、DCS等设备实时采集。
业务数据:ERP/MES系统数据(如工单、库存)通过API对接。
第三方数据:天气、地理信息(如OpenStreetMap)用于环境建模。

数据处理

边缘层:过滤噪声数据、执行简单逻辑(如阈值判断)。
云端:存储历史数据,通过机器学习训练预测模型(如LSTM预测设备寿命)。

4. 虚拟模型与数据集成

模型驱动集成

通过数字线程(Digital Thread)打通设计、制造、运维数据,例如PTC Windchill连接CAD与IoT数据。
时间同步:确保虚拟模型与物理实体状态实时对齐(如毫秒级时间戳校准)。

仿真引擎部署

实时仿真:基于实时数据驱动模型动态更新(如流体仿真实时显示管道流量变化)。
离线仿真:利用历史数据模拟极端工况(如设备过载测试)。

5. 应用开发与价值输出

核心功能开发

监控与诊断:实时仪表盘显示设备状态,异常时触发报警(如温度超限红色高亮)。
预测与优化:通过AI模型预测故障概率,生成维护建议(如“3天后更换轴承”)。
决策支持:仿真不同方案的效果(如调整产线节拍对产能的影响)。

交互方式

网页端:Three.js开发3D可视化界面,支持缩放、旋转查看模型细节。
AR/VR:现场工程师通过AR眼镜查看设备数字孪生,叠加维修指南。

6. 持续迭代与优化

模型校准:定期对比物理实体与虚拟模型的输出,修正仿真参数(如材料老化系数)。
功能扩展:根据业务需求新增分析模块(如能耗分析、碳排放计算)。
性能优化:通过边缘计算减少云端数据传输压力,使用GPU加速复杂仿真。

三、行业应用示例

工业制造

工具:西门子NX(CAD建模)+ MindSphere(IoT平台)+ Tecnomatix(生产流程仿真)。
场景:产线数字孪生实时监控设备OEE(设备综合效率),预测停机风险。

智慧城市

工具:CityEngine(城市建模)+ Unity(可视化)+ Azure IoT(交通数据接入)。
场景:模拟暴雨内涝时的排水系统压力,优化泵站调度策略。

医疗健康

工具:3D Slicer(医学影像建模)+ ANSYS(器官力学仿真)。
场景:术前数字孪生模拟手术路径,降低手术风险。

四、关键挑战与应对

数据安全:采用边缘计算本地化处理敏感数据,传输加密(如TLS协议)。
模型精度:结合物理机理模型与数据驱动模型(如“机理+AI”混合建模)。
实时性要求:使用分布式计算架构(如Kubernetes集群)提升仿真速度。

通过以上工具和方法,可实现从设备级到系统级的数字孪生构建,助力各行业实现“虚实映射、实时诊断、智能决策”的目标。具体实施时需根据场景需求选择工具组合,平衡精度、成本与实时性。

© 版权声明
THE END
如果内容对您有所帮助,就支持一下吧!
点赞0 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容